Summary
This is an entry level position for recent electrical engineering (or similar technical degrees) graduates with little practical experience but show potential through education or other manufacturing work related experiences. To provide engineering support for plant electrical systems for equipment, facilities, and utilities. Ensures electrical systems and components meet required specifications for safety, economy, reliability and sustainability.
Responsibilities
- Understands safety is everyone’s first priority and completes OSHA 10 training
- Learns and understands plant electrical distribution system, NEC, NFPA70E, and UL requirements
- Learns and understands all facility related equipment, systems, and processes
- Support maintenance and engineering projects during shutdowns and TPM’s
- Works with maintenance team, contractors, and vendors to procure parts and services
- Ensures equipment installations meet safety, quality and productivity specifications
- Creates, modifies and maintains drawings using AutoCad or similar software package
- Learn the basics of project management, Emaint, contractor/vendor quotes and SAP purchase requisitions
- Troubleshoots equipment problems, be available to collaborate and participate in cross-functional problem-solving teams
- Provide support for shift boiler techs and learn basic PM’s required to maintain equipment in a 24/7 environment
- Understand plantwide fire sprinkler and alarm systems and learn about FM Global requirements
